⚙️ TECHNICAL FEATURES & MATERIAL PRECISION

MERIT replacement pistons are engineered to match original material tolerances perfectly, ensuring survival within high-frequency mechanical shock fields.

  • High-Purity Fatigue-Resistant Steel: Forged from vacuum-degassed alloy steel containing precise balances of chromium, nickel, and molybdenum (Cr−Ni−Mo) to ensure long-term structural elasticity.
  • Isothermal Case Hardening: Deep-case carburized and tempered to achieve a surface hardness of 60–62 HRCwhile leaving a highly ductile internal core. This ensures the impact face can strike the chisel millions of times without fracturing or mushrooming.
  • Micro-Accuracy Finish: Precision-ground on advanced centerless CNC machinery to ensure exact geometric cylindrical alignment, minimizing friction and preventing internal cylinder bore scoring.

💡 SYSTEM FUNCTIONALITY & COMPONENT ROLE

The strike piston is the dynamic core of the Rammer G80 hydraulic breaker. Suspended within the main cylinder block by high-pressure elastomeric seal groups, this high-mass component undergoes continuous, extreme-velocity reciprocating cycles.

The primary engineering function of the piston is to store energy and convert fluid power into impact force. During the hydraulic travel phase, high-pressure oil forces the piston upward, which directly compresses the nitrogen gas (N2​) cushion inside the back-head. When the main control valve cycles, it releases this oil pressure, allowing the compressed nitrogen gas to expand violently and drive the piston downward into the striking face of the working tool.

For the Rammer G80 to achieve its full impact energy potential, the piston surface must maintain an ultra-tight fluid boundary to prevent high-pressure bypass oil from leaking past the seals, which would reduce blow frequency and striking power.
